Warning Signs You Need Concrete Water Damage Restoration

Early detection is key to preventing costly repairs and further damage. Keep an eye out for these warning signs: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

A persistent musty smell can show hidden water damage or a damp environment. Don’t ignore it – our team can help you identify the source and provide a solution. Don’t let hidden damage spread and worsen.

Water Stains or Discoloration

Visible water stains or discoloration on your concrete surfaces can be a sign of water damage. Our team will assess the damage and provide a plan to restore your property. Don’t let water damage spread and create more problems.

Cracks or Buckling in Concrete

Cracks or buckling in concrete can be a sign of structural damage or water infiltration. Our team will assess the damage and provide a plan to repair or replace the affected area. Don’t let small issues become major problems.

Water Accumulation or Puddling

Water accumulation or puddling around your property can be a sign of a larger issue, such as a clogged drain or foundation problem. Our team will assess the damage and provide a plan to address the issue. Don’t let hidden problems cause further damage.

Uneven or Sagging Floors

Uneven or sagging floors can be a sign of water damage or a structural issue. Our team will assess the damage and provide a plan to repair or replace the affected area. Don’t let small issues become major problems.

Peeling Paint or Drywall

Peeling paint or drywall can be a sign of water damage or a hidden leak. Our team will assess the damage and provide a plan to restore your property. Don’t let hidden damage spread and worsen.

Concrete Water Damage Restoration Cost in Davidson, NC

Prices for Concrete Water Damage Restoration in Davidson, NC, can vary depending on the severity, size, and location of the affected area. These estimates are based on our team’s experience and may not reflect your specific situation. Get a free estimate from our team to find out the best course of action for your property.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of water damage, and equipment required.
Structural Repair and Reconstruction $1,000 – $10,000 Location and extent of structural damage, materials and labor required.
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of surfaces, and materials required.
Final Inspection and Follow-up $200 – $500 Extent of damage, complexity of repairs, and number of follow-up visits.

Keep in mind that these estimates are based on our team’s experience and may not reflect your specific situation. A free estimate from our team will provide a more accurate assessment of the costs involved.
